North Shore Level 2 Electrician Protecting Homes with Safe Installations

In the North Shore of NSW, guaranteeing a consistent supply of electricity throughout the diverse terrain is an amazing the know-how and adherence to policies by North Shore Level 2 Electricians. These experts, called Accredited Service Providers (ASPs), hold an unique accreditation mandated by the state that permits them to work on the electrical facilities, particularly the service line equipment connecting properties to the primary power grid of the distributor. Their specialized permission sets them apart from routine electricians, who concentrate on internal circuitry and switchboards within a property. Due to the threats associated with working straight with the network, this sophisticated accreditation and training are required to ensure the security, compliance, and dependability of every connection.

The scope of services provided by a North Shore Level 2 Electrician is broad and basically attends to the critical "bridge" between the general public power infrastructure and a personal property. Among the most typical and vital jobs is power supply upgrades. As North Shore homes are remodelled, expanded, or geared up with modern-day, high-demand appliances-- such as ducted air conditioning, electrical automobile battery chargers, or big solar arrays-- the existing single-phase power connection or aging consumer mains frequently end up being insufficient. A North Shore Level 2 Electrician is the only professional lawfully certified to evaluate the load requirements, change the customer mains (the durable cable televisions ranging from the street to the switchboard), and carry out the necessary work to upgrade the supply to a three-phase system, where required. This ability is necessary for future-proofing homes and commercial facilities against increasing energy consumption.

In the face of building and advancement, a North Shore Level 2 Electrician plays an important role. For new builds, they are responsible for establishing the entire new connection to the electrical grid, whether it involves overhead service lines run from a power pole or the setup of underground cabling. They manage the installation of the Point of Accessory (POA) bracket, the service defense device, the electrical meter, and all associated equipment. Additionally, they are the suppliers who website can set up short-lived home builder's power supply, making sure that construction sites throughout the North Shore have safe, compliant, and easily available power from day one. This end-to-end service, from network connection to energisation, simplifies the structure process substantially.

In case of unforeseen circumstances, like storm-related damage to power infrastructure or internal problems that activate network security systems, the specialized skills of a North Shore Level 2 Electrician are promptly needed. These specialists provide 24/7 emergency situation services to promptly identify and solve vital network faults. Their duties include fixing or replacing privately owned power poles, along with securely restoring broken overhead or underground power lines that may have been compromised by accidents or natural catastrophes. The electrician's capacity to perform live work under carefully managed conditions, or to securely detach and reconnect the power supply, is essential for making sure both security and the fast reinstatement of electrical services to domestic and commercial homes throughout the North Shore.

A typical task for a North Shore Level 2 Electrician includes dealing with electrical defect notifications from the network operator. These notifications, frequently prompted by regular inspections or devices faults, require that unsafe or non-compliant devices on the service side be fixed by a recognized expert within a particular timeframe. These problems lie on the network side and can not be dealt with by a routine electrician. A North Shore Level 2 Electrician is experienced in not only carrying out the needed repairs to meet regulative requirements however also in completing and sending the needed documents to officially deal with the defect and prevent supply disconnection.

A North Shore Level 2 Electrician needs specialized skills, especially in metering services. They are licensed to set up, move, or upgrade metering devices, consisting of new smart meters changing older models. Their job involves guaranteeing the meter setup precisely reflects unique energy generation systems like solar power, by setting up import/export plans correctly. Working within strict national and state guidelines, these specialists show high requirements. With know-how in overhead and underground installations, metering, and emergency repair work, North Shore Level 2 Electricians play a crucial role in keeping electrical safety and dependability for all homes in the region.
